Monmouth: Trial By Combat provides a faithful, gritty examination of the pivotal Battle of Monmouth, fought on June 28, 1778. As Sir Henry Clinton's British column attempts to navigate the oppressive heat of the New Jersey wilderness while protecting a massive baggage train, they are harried by American forces. The narrative centers on the command crisis precipitated by Major General Charles Lee, whose skepticism of the Continental Army's capabilities leads to an unauthorized, chaotic retreat. The crisis is met by the direct, physical intervention of General George Washington, who rides into the fray to rally his men and establish a line of defense that shocks the British command. The ensuing struggle transforms into a brutal contest of attrition, characterized by the scorching heat, disciplined artillery barrages, and the final, failed assault by British Grenadiers. Beyond the tactical victory, the book explores the aftermath-the court-martial of Lee and the emergence of a matured, seasoned Continental Army that has finally proven its ability to stand against the finest infantry in the world.
